I got a Chromecast at the weekend and reckon its generally pretty cool.
I have it hooked up to a permanent USB power supply (no USB ports on my TV or Amp to switch on/off with the TV unfortunately). So its on all the time (or was).
I saw the lovely screensaver/background - but noticed it never goes to sleep - it got me thinking about data use.
A few google queries tells me that the device could use between 10 and 20 MB each and every hour its on.
So around 7-14GB per month??
Its fine if you live on an uncapped data plan, but its not insignificant on an 80GB plan - especially when I was considering buying a second chromecast.
There is no way I have found to disable the background. I logged an issue via the google system suggesting they have an option to not display any background. It pays to complain directly - but who knows if they will take notice - it doesnt appear to be a new issue.
Some people have set up their own blank image and tried to get the CC to use this - apparently it then just starts using the google image gallery again.
